GoFundMe Hosting SXSW Panel on Women’s Leadership & Innovation in Philanthropy

On Friday, March 7, GoFundMe will host a panel at SXSW 2025 about women’s innovation and leadership in philanthropy.

The event, titled “Women are Changing the Game of Giving,” will explore how women and girls – from prominent philanthropists like MacKenzie Scott and Melinda French Gates to community leaders and advocates – are shaping the future of giving. Attendees will walk away with an understanding of the progress that has been made toward gender equity in philanthropy and what can be done about the gaps that remain.

The panel will feature an exciting lineup of speakers – including Margaret Richardson, Chief Corporate Affairs Officer at GoFundMe; Angelique Albert, CEO of Native Forward Scholars Fund; and Sarah Haacke Byrd, CEO of Women Moving Millions.
